| Subcribe via RSS

Introducción a Google Maps (III)

Abril 28th, 2006 Posted in google

Vamos a empezar esta tercera entrega añadiendo unos botones que permiten cambiar estre las distintas vistas que ofrece Google Maps: visión satélite, mapa o vista híbrida. Como siempre un ejemplo.

Para mostrar estos botones tenemos que añadir a nuestro “programa”:

map.addControl(new GMapTypeControl());

Estos botones, y todos los mensajes que se muestran en el mapa, salen en inglés por defecto. Podemos cambiar el idioma de los botones modificando la línea desde la que llamamos a la API de Google Maps:

añadiendo al final:

&hl=es

es decir:

hl es el código con el que le indicamos a Google Maps el idioma que queremos usar. Por ahora están disponibles estos idiomas:

Japanese (ja), French (fr), German (de), Italian (it), Spanish (es), Catalan (ca), Basque (eu) and Galician (gl).

Mostrar un mensaje

Vamos a añadir una nueva tontería a nuestra pequeña aplicación; esta vez vamos a ver cómo añadir un mensaje dentro del mapa. Para que te hagas una idea vamos a ver cómo mostrar el mensaje de este ejemplo.

Es tan sencillo como añadir la siguiente línea:

map.openInfoWindow(map.getCenter(), document.createTextNode("Yo estuve aquí una vez"));

Este método funciona así:

openInfoWindow(coordenadas,  nodo,  opciones)

- coordenadas: es un objeto del tipo GLatLng. En el ejemplo le hemos pasado las coordenadas del centro del mapa: map.getCenter().
- nodo: el texto que queremos mostrar, en el ejemplo hemos puesto document.createTextNode("Yo estuve aquí una vez").
- opciones: objeto del tipo GInfoWindowOptions. Por ahora lo dejamos en blanco, es optativo.

Entradas relacionadas

  1. Introducción a Google Maps (II)
  2. Introducción a Google Maps
  3. Google Maps Europa ya está en marcha
  4. Introducción a PHPMailer
  5. Phishing en Google Adwords
Valoración:
1 Estrella2 Estrellas3 Estrellas4 Estrellas5 Estrellas (Sin calificar)
Loading ... Loading ...

Leave a Reply